摘 要: 介绍了氯苯类化合物的结构、性质、污染现状。在对催化臭氧技术降解氯苯类化合物效能评述的基础上,针对催化臭氧机理研究的难点进行了分析,重点讨论了催化臭氧产生羟基自由基(·OH)的机理、降解氯苯类化合物的作用、影响因素等,最后讨论了该技术的研究方向。 Structure, properties and present situation of pollution of chlorobenzenes were introduced. The degradation efficiency of chlorobenzenes(CBs) by the catalytic ozonation was reviewed. The reaction mechanism of the catalytic ozonation was discussed. And more attention was focused on the discussion of the generated mechanism of hydroxyl radicals(.OH) , the degradation mechanism and influencing factors of chlorobenzenes(CBs) that may exist in the catalytic ozonation process. At last the research direction of the catalytic ozonation was discussioned.
